You might wonder what exactly the P-Shot entails. It’s a straightforward p shot treatment that harnesses platelet-rich plasma (PRP) from your blood to rejuvenate penile tissue. Doctors draw a small amount of blood from your arm, spin it in a centrifuge to concentrate the platelets – those healing powerhouses – and then inject the PRP directly into key areas of the penis. This penis shot stimulates growth factors that repair damaged vessels and nerves, directly tackling the root causes of ED.

How does it solve erectile dysfunction? ED often stems from poor blood flow, nerve damage, or tissue degradation – issues that worsen with age, diabetes, or lifestyle factors. The P-Shot counters this by promoting angiogenesis, the formation of new blood vessels, which improves circulation. Better blood flow means firmer, more sustainable erections. The Science Behind How the P-Shot Tackles ED

Let’s break it down further. When you get aroused, your brain signals nerves to relax penile muscles, allowing blood to rush in and create an erection. ED disrupts this process, often due to endothelial dysfunction – where vessel linings don’t work properly. The P-Shot’s PRP is rich in growth factors like VEGF and PDGF, which repair these linings and boost nitric oxide production, essential for relaxation.

The P-Shot Procedure: What to Expect Step by Step

Walking into a clinic for a P injection might sound daunting, but it’s quick and comfortable. First, your doctor discusses your goals – ED resolution, enlargement, or both. They take a blood sample, process it for PRP (about 15 minutes), and apply numbing cream or a local anaesthetic to ensure minimal discomfort.

The injections target the shaft and glans, taking just 10 minutes. Post-procedure, you might use a penis pump briefly to optimise distribution. There’s no downtime – head back to your London routine immediately. Most men resume sexual activity the same day, though full results build over weeks.

Risks and Side Effects: Keeping It Real

The P-Shot is safe, with risks like bruising or swelling in 10-15% of cases. Infection is rare (0.1%), and since it’s autologous, no allergies. Discomfort is minimal with numbing. Always choose qualified providers to avoid issues.
